When you look at MCA financing, the price isn't a flat fee. It usually depends on your company's daily transaction volume, your industry type, and how long you have been operating. Lenders check your cash flow to gauge risk, which directly influences the factor rate applied to your advance. If your business has steady, high-volume deposits, you might see better terms. Conversely, businesses with fluctuating sales or shorter track records might see higher rates to offset the lender's risk. While factor rates typically range from 1.1 to 1.5, your specific situation dictates the final number.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

MCA stands for Merchant Cash Advance. It's a financial transaction where a business sells a portion of its future credit card receivables for immediate cash. It's not technically a loan, as it's based on sales volume rather than a fixed repayment schedule. This offers flexibility for businesses in Port St. Lucie. We can explain the differences.
